Transaction 17faf24eaaa9c342023ce79a7093c678c9debecab26b78adcf879f9f26a1f370

1 Input
2 Outputs
  • 17faf24eaaa9c342023ce79a7093c678c9debecab26b78adcf879f9f26a1f370:0
  • value  483000
    address  3JiwwQFNK7uTRuXHZWRvVE8quegccDhADq
  • 17faf24eaaa9c342023ce79a7093c678c9debecab26b78adcf879f9f26a1f370:1
  • value  7576800
    address  1UFnftocWG5iWjsqd8kvZvJxQnJ2oYNwp